Sure, it may feel like a bit from a Monty Python movie, but the reality surrounding the so-called “death of the media” is maybe not as bleak as one might be persuaded to believe. Slowly but surely, we are seeing a variety of new media business models start to trickle out, with companies like Blendle, Texture, and AdBlock Plus (really!) finding ways to help the media monetize its content. |

My wife and I were among the 150,000 people who Mark Kennedy, AP’s Drama Writer, reports watched the December 10 live-streaming of the off-Broadway musical “Daddy Long Legs” via the Internet. We thought it was wonderful, as did many others, and now, no surprise, comes confirmation that the show’s producer was indeed excited by the response. |
